Analysis
Europe & Central Asia recorded 1.06 units per square kilometre for population ages 55-59, male, per square kilometre in 2023.
Compared with earlier readings it is down 0.6% on the previous year and up 7.2% over ten years.
Over the whole period, population ages 55-59, male, per square kilometre in Europe & Central Asia peaked at 3.93 units per square kilometre in 1986 and was at its lowest, 0.6899 units per square kilometre, in 2001.
Europe & Central Asia ranks 23rd of 43 groups on this measure, in the middle of the range.
The series is highly variable year to year, so single readings are best treated with caution.

How this figure is calculated
Population ages 55-59, male divided by Land area (sq. km), matched on country and year. Neither publisher issues this ratio as a series; it is computed here from both.
Population ages 55-59, male ÷ Land area (sq. km)
Computed from
- Population ages 55-59, male World Bank staff estimates using the World Bank's total population and age/sex distributions of the United Nations Population Division's World Population Prospects
- Land area FAOSTAT, Food and Agriculture Organization of the United Nations (FAO)
Statizoid computes this series; the underlying measurements belong to the publishers named above. The arithmetic is applied to every country and year where both inputs report, and nothing is estimated unless the page says so.
